Un procesador de doble núcleo es una CPU con dos núcleos separados en la misma matriz, cada uno con su propia caché. Es el equivalente de tener dos microprocesadores en uno.
En una cuerda de un solo núcleo o procesador tradicional se alimenta a la CPU de instrucciones que debe ordenar, ejecutar, a continuación, de forma selectiva almacenar en su memoria caché para una rápida recuperación. Cuando se requiere de datos fuera de la caché, se recupera a través del bus de sistema de memoria de acceso aleatorio (RAM) o desde dispositivos de almacenamiento. El acceso a estos ralentiza el rendimiento a la velocidad máxima del bus, la memoria RAM o dispositivo de almacenamiento que permitirá, que es mucho más lento que la velocidad de la CPU. La situación se agrava cuando multi-tarea. En este caso el procesador debe alternar entre dos o más conjuntos de flujos de datos y programas. Se agotan los recursos de la CPU y el rendimiento se resiente.
Un valor atractivo de los procesadores de doble núcleo es que no requieren una nueva placa madre, pero puede ser utilizado en las placas existentes que cuentan la toma correcta. Para el usuario promedio de la diferencia en el rendimiento será más notable en las tareas múltiples hasta que el software es más consciente de SMT. Los servidores que ejecutan múltiples procesadores de doble núcleo a ver un aumento apreciable en el rendimiento.
En una cuerda de un solo núcleo o procesador tradicional se alimenta a la CPU de instrucciones que debe ordenar, ejecutar, a continuación, de forma selectiva almacenar en su memoria caché para una rápida recuperación. Cuando se requiere de datos fuera de la caché, se recupera a través del bus de sistema de memoria de acceso aleatorio (RAM) o desde dispositivos de almacenamiento. El acceso a estos ralentiza el rendimiento a la velocidad máxima del bus, la memoria RAM o dispositivo de almacenamiento que permitirá, que es mucho más lento que la velocidad de la CPU. La situación se agrava cuando multi-tarea. En este caso el procesador debe alternar entre dos o más conjuntos de flujos de datos y programas. Se agotan los recursos de la CPU y el rendimiento se resiente.
Un valor atractivo de los procesadores de doble núcleo es que no requieren una nueva placa madre, pero puede ser utilizado en las placas existentes que cuentan la toma correcta. Para el usuario promedio de la diferencia en el rendimiento será más notable en las tareas múltiples hasta que el software es más consciente de SMT. Los servidores que ejecutan múltiples procesadores de doble núcleo a ver un aumento apreciable en el rendimiento.
No hay comentarios:
Publicar un comentario